Hanger, Inc., a leading provider of orthotic and prosthetic (O&P) services and products, offers advanced solutions, clinically differentiated programs, and unparalleled customer service. The Patient Care segment operates the largest network of O&P patient care clinics, while the Products & Services segment distributes branded and private label O&P devices and provides rehabilitative solutions.
